引言
高等数学中的矩阵理论是现代数学和工程学中不可或缺的一部分。它不仅为抽象数学理论提供了强有力的工具,而且在现实世界的许多领域中都有着广泛的应用。本文将深入探讨矩阵理论的基本概念,并分析其在各个领域的实际应用。
矩阵理论基础知识
1. 矩阵的定义与表示
矩阵是由一系列数字组成的矩形阵列,通常用大写字母表示,如 (A)。矩阵的行和列分别用下标表示,如 (A_{ij}) 表示矩阵 (A) 中第 (i) 行第 (j) 列的元素。
2. 矩阵的运算
矩阵的基本运算包括加法、减法、乘法等。其中,矩阵乘法是矩阵理论的核心内容之一。
import numpy as np
# 定义两个矩阵
A = np.array([[1, 2], [3, 4]])
B = np.array([[2, 0], [1, 3]])
# 矩阵乘法
C = np.dot(A, B)
print(C)
3. 特征值与特征向量
特征值和特征向量是矩阵理论中的重要概念,它们在工程学、物理学等领域有着广泛的应用。
# 计算矩阵的特征值和特征向量
eigenvalues, eigenvectors = np.linalg.eig(A)
print("特征值:", eigenvalues)
print("特征向量:", eigenvectors)
矩阵理论在现实世界的应用
1. 信号处理
在信号处理领域,矩阵理论被广泛应用于滤波、压缩、解卷积等方面。
2. 机器学习
在机器学习中,矩阵理论用于处理数据、进行线性代数运算、优化算法等。
3. 计算机图形学
在计算机图形学中,矩阵理论用于实现变换、投影、光照等效果。
4. 量子计算
量子计算领域的研究也依赖于矩阵理论,用于描述量子态、量子门等概念。
结论
矩阵理论是高等数学中的重要组成部分,其在现实世界的应用广泛而深远。通过深入了解矩阵理论,我们可以更好地理解世界,为科技创新贡献力量。
